Siteco Electrical Installation

siteco installation materials Scope and application

Fit-outs move fast when every bracket, gland, and fastener lands correctly the first time. Siteco supplies a coherent set for indoor grids, façades, and industrial bays: corrosion-resistant metals, HF/LSF plastics, and sealing parts that keep IP intact after the second and third maintenance cycle. Ratings and dimensions are published—thread families, torque windows, conductor ranges, glow-wire classes—so ceiling plans translate to the shop floor without guesswork.

siteco mounting systems Mechanical options and load data

Suspension kits cover wire-rope (1.5–3.0 mm) with keyed grippers, rigid rod sets (M6/M8/M10), and cantilever arms for wall/beam mounting. Typical SWLs: 30–120 kg per point with 5:1 safety factors; shock-tested brackets are available for sports halls. Galvanized and A2/A4 stainless variants handle coastal or CIP zones. Slotted rails keep tolerances forgiving—±3 mm play helps align long trunking runs. Impact and vibration data follow EN 62262 and IEC 60068; use locknuts or thread-locking washers above moving machinery.

Thermal and ingress behavior

Outdoor heads see wide deltas. Brackets specify −30…+70 °C service; powder coats meet ISO 9227 salt-spray classes. For canopy fixtures, choose gasketed interfaces and preserve drain paths—blocking weeps is a common cause of condensation alarms.

Technical specifications and standards

Empty housings and junction parts follow EN 62208; boxes and device interfaces reference EN 60670-1/-22. IP ratings per EN 60529; glow-wire to IEC 60695-2-11 (750–960 °C). Metallic parts use ISO 3506 fasteners; load declarations cite test direction and torque. For suspended lines, wire systems comply with EN 13411 ferrule and termination guidance. Where luminaires include SELV, keep segregation clearances per EN 60598; EMC practice follows EN 55015/EN 61547 with shielding maintained by the entry hardware.

siteco conduit systems Routing and segregation

Conduit families include halogen-free corrugated (HF/LSF), rigid PVC-U for interiors, and stainless or galvanised steel for exposed plant. Typical crush ratings 320–750 N/5 cm by size; UV-stable jackets for roofs. Fittings are IP54–IP67 with elastomer seals; glands and locknuts are sized to maintain enclosure IP. Maintain segregation: power in metallic path where VFDs run, control/SELV in HF plastic, fiber in dedicated pass-throughs. Bending radii and pull tensions are printed per size so installers can set rollers and avoid ovalising.

Junctions and branch points

Use tee boxes with molded bosses for DIN terminals; torque and strip lengths are embossed. Earthing studs are captive—short PE jumpers keep loop impedance low on metal runs. Label fields accept solvent-resistant markers; auditors appreciate that tiny detail.

Installation practice and compatibility

Plasterboard ceilings: adjustable pattress plates recover cutout drift; low-profile grips stop telegraphing on thin tiles. Concrete: wedge anchors with ETA marks; mind edge distances. Steel: clamp packs avoid drilling primary beams; verify flange thickness before site night. When drawings call out siteco installation accessories, list thread, torque, IP class, and substrate on the tag—procurement errors vanish when those four lines are explicit.

Cable entry is where many jobs stumble. Pair gland threads to plate thickness; long-thread bodies prevent star-cracking on sandwich doors. For EMC, bond 360° at the gland and keep pigtails short. Where luminaires are daisy-chained, pre-terminated whips with coded plugs reduce ceiling time and polarity mistakes—especially on emergency circuits.

Electrical interfaces and testing

Use ferrules sized to the conductor class; most terminals accept 0.5…2.5 mm² on lighting circuits, up to 6 mm² on feeds. Publish torque on drawings: 0.5–0.6 N·m for small clamps, 1.2–1.8 N·m on bars—over-compression is the silent killer of IP seals. Continuity and insulation tests should be run with optics disconnected where the driver requires; Siteco drivers state maximum test voltage and duration to protect input stages.

Controls, dimming, and accessories

For DALI loops, hold total length within guidance and leave 20 % bus headroom; addressable jobs fail when the loop current budget is ignored. Where phase-cut remains, isolate dimmers from inductive feeders and respect inrush diversity. Logistics and field notes

Two practical tips from rollouts: order spare gaskets and screw kits with the first drop—missing seals cause most late-night IP issues; standardise two suspension lengths per floor—wire clutter disappears and laser lines stay straight. siteco lighting installation kits Pre-engineered sets for faster nights

Room packs bundle brackets, entry glands, junction parts, and labeling. Pick sets by luminaire family and ceiling type; the BOM lists torque, drill sizes, and conductor windows. Emergency nodes include maintained/unmaintained legends and test-port adapters. For cold-stores, kits switch to silicone seals and anti-condensation vents.
